Abstract

1,2-Disubstituted imidazoline, such as 1-stearoly aminoethyl-2- heptadecyl imidazoline (SHI), 1-stearoyl dis (aminoethyl)-2- heptadecyl imidazoline(SDI) and 1-stearoyl tris (aminoethyl) -2-heptadecyl imidazoline(STI) were synthesized from stearic acid with polyalkylene polyamine, and then water-soluble 1,2-disubstituted imidazolinium salts, such as 1-stearoyl aminoethyl-1-glycidyl -2-heptadecyl imidazolinium chloride(SHIC), 1-stearoyl dis(aminoethyl)-1-glycidyl-2-heptadecyl imidazolinium chloride(STIC), 1-stearoyl aminoethyl-2-heptadecyl imidazolinium chloride(SAIC) and 1-stearoyl aminoethyl-1-benzyl-2-heptadecyl imidazolinium chloride(SBIC) were obtained by alkylating 1,2-disubstituted imidazoline with epichlorohydrin, hydrochloric acid and benzyl chloride. It was found that SHIC, SDIC and STIC could be used as the durable softening and water-repellenting agent, from the results of the measurements of the water repellency of fabrics treated with SHIC, SDIC, STIC, SAIC and SBIC. The structures of these compounds were also determined by elemental analyses and IR spectra.
